The Vice President and current flagbearer of the New Patriotic Party, H.E Dr. Mahamudu Bawumia has announced his intentions to actively involve the church in governance considering its vital role in national development.

Addressing a clergy in Accra on Tuesday, June 4, as part of his campaign tour in the Greater Accra Region, the Vice President had stated his aims to fashion a much closer relationship between the church and Government.

He further emphasized some of the active roles of the church in National development while affirming the need to incentivize the church to contribute more to Education.

“The next area of reform I want to do is to bring a much closer partnership between the church and Government in Ghana here. Right now, I believe that we are not making enough use of the church. The church is our foremost development partner, our development partners are not the external ones.”

“We have to encourage the church to do more, so I want a closer partnership, especially in the area of the management of our schools.”

He also added his intentions to provide free tertiary education to persons living with disability as well as provide for them, quotas of employment within the public services, as part of his vision if he wins the 2024 elections.

“I care a lot about persons with disability and I want to provide free tertiary education for persons with disability in this country. They have some of the sharpest minds that we have but physically they are not able, but it’s not inability and sometimes because of their physical disability they get disadvantaged in so many areas and are unable to afford tertiary education. We will give them tertiary education and some quotas for the employment of persons with disability in the public service”
